Fairfield's real estate market presents compelling opportunities for first-time buyers. With median home prices significantly lower than surrounding Bay Area counties, buyers gain substantial purchasing power. The market features steady appreciation, competitive inventory levels, and diverse property types from condos to single-family homes. Strong job growth at nearby Travis Air Force Base and local employers supports long-term property values. First-time buyers benefit from seller incentives and conventional financing options in this balanced market.
First-time buyer homes in Fairfield typically range from $350,000 to $550,000 for single-family residences. Condos and townhomes offer entry points from $250,000 to $400,000. California first-time buyer programs may assist with down payments up to 3-5%.

Get pre-approved before house hunting to strengthen your offer. Research first-time buyer programs offering down payment assistance and tax credits. Work with local agents familiar with Fairfield neighborhoods and school districts. Consider future resale value when selecting properties. Factor in property taxes, HOA fees, and insurance costs. Attend home inspection thoroughly and negotiate repairs. Save for closing costs beyond the down payment.

Fairfield blends suburban charm with modern amenities across diverse neighborhoods. The Downtown area features walkable shops, restaurants, and cultural venues. Green Valley offers spacious lots and family-friendly atmosphere. Rockville area provides affordable options near schools and parks. Excellent schools including Fairfield Unified School District attract young families. Local parks, recreation centers, and sports facilities serve active communities. Growing employment sectors and reasonable cost of living make Fairfield increasingly attractive.
